A Trio of Films That Examines Play
Featuring the work of Stacey Steers, Charlotte Pryce, and Gina Kamestky
Guest Curator: Laura Heit
A trio of films that carefully examines play; by reconfiguring, and relocating once discarded images, building layers, and creating new meaning. A hockey game is replayed using erasure and a lyrical hand painted line to examine the beauty and rhythm in this bloody sport. Another buries generations’ past evening entertainment in the garden and unearths new complex stories for bedtime. Colors unlike anything we relate to dirt, sublime in their secret history.
